State Police Investigate Fatal Crash on Route 495 South in Wrentham

On Friday, May 16, 2008 at approximately 8:00 p.m. Troopers assigned to the State Police Barracks in Foxboro responded to a one vehicle crash on 495 South prior to Route 1A (exit 15) in the Town of Wrentham that resulted in one fatality.

Preliminary investigation by Trooper Allen Luther indicates that 58-year-old Conrad Lindsay of Leicester was operating a 1998 Ford Escort in the right travel lane of Route 495 South when he lost control of his vehicle, exited the roadway to the left and entered the median. After entering the median, the Ford struck a dirt embankment and rolled over. Lindsay, who was not wearing his safety belt, was ejected from the vehicle during the crash. He sustained serious injuries and was transported by ambulance to Milford Hospital where he was later pronounced deceased.

This crash remains under investigation with the assistance of the State Police Collision Analysis and Reconstruction Section. The Wrentham Fire Department, Franklin Fire Department, Wrentham Police Department and MassHighway assisted Troopers at the scene.

Due to the investigation and vehicle removal, the left lane of Route 495 South was closed for over an hour.
